"This hostel is fairly new and attractive, and affords some marvelous views over the city from its hillside perch about a kilometer (1/2 mile) from the terminal of the Righi funicular...in a safe area." Full review
"Genoa’s HI hostel is clean and well run, although its out-oftown location means you will be heavily reliant on buses... Closed 11.30am–2.30pm."

"An haute-design hotel in the city center." Full review
"The faded grandeur has been revived by stylish decor and simple, minimalist furniture that doesn’t detract from the original stucco ceilings and window details."
"A combination of historic and contemporary styles, in a prestigious palazzo."
"Despite the pricey furnishings and hi-tech gadgetry, it's extremely kid-friendly." Full review
